What is Commercial Property?
Commercial property is any real estate used for business purposes. Unlike residential property, which is meant for living, commercial property is designed for work, trade, or earning revenue. Examples of commercial property include:
-
Office spaces
-
Shops and retail outlets
-
Warehouses
-
Industrial buildings
-
Malls and showrooms
Owning or renting a commercial property allows businesses to operate legally, attract customers, and expand their operations.

Types of Commercial Property in Delhi
If you are planning to invest in commercial property in Delhi, it is important to know the types of properties available.
1. Office Spaces
Office spaces are one of the most common commercial properties in Delhi. They can range from small offices for startups to large corporate buildings. Key points to consider:
-
Location: Business hubs like Connaught Place, Saket, and Gurugram are popular.
-
Size: Office spaces vary from 500 sq. ft to more than 10,000 sq. ft.
-
Facilities: Parking, internet connectivity, security, and lifts are important for offices.
2. Retail Shops
Retail shops are commercial properties where goods are sold directly to customers. They can be in malls, streets, or shopping complexes. Key points:
-
High footfall areas attract more customers.
-
Shops in markets like Karol Bagh, Chandni Chowk, and Lajpat Nagar are very popular.
-
Leasing or buying shops can give good rental income.
3. Warehouses
Warehouses are used for storage and logistics purposes. Delhi and nearby areas have many warehouses to support businesses. Key points:
-
Industrial areas like Bawana, Okhla, and Kundli are known for warehouses.
-
Warehouses need good transport connectivity for easy distribution.
-
Large warehouses are ideal for e-commerce companies.
4. Showrooms and Malls
Showrooms and malls are large commercial properties used for display and retail of goods. Key points:
-
Areas like Connaught Place, Vasant Kunj, and DLF Promenade are known for showrooms.
-
Malls attract more customers and are suitable for brand businesses.
5. Industrial Buildings
Industrial buildings are mainly for manufacturing and production purposes. They require large spaces and proper infrastructure. Key points:
-
Industrial zones like Mayapuri and Narela are popular.
-
These properties often have specialized facilities like power supply and heavy machinery setup.
Factors to Consider Before Buying Commercial Property in Delhi
Buying or leasing commercial property is a big decision. There are several factors to consider before making a choice:
1. Location
Location is one of the most important factors. A good location attracts more customers and increases business visibility. For example, retail shops need areas with high foot traffic, while warehouses need areas with good transport connectivity.
2. Budget and Financing
Commercial properties are more expensive than residential ones. You should decide your budget carefully and explore financing options like bank loans or commercial property mortgages.
3. Legal Compliance
Check the property’s legal documents carefully. Ensure that it has clear titles, no disputes, and proper approvals from authorities. This avoids legal problems in the future.
4. Infrastructure and Facilities
Good infrastructure is essential for smooth business operations. Check for:
-
Electricity and water supply
-
Internet and telecommunication
-
Parking space
-
Security arrangements
5. Rental and ROI
If you are investing in commercial property, calculate potential rental income and return on investment (ROI). Some properties give higher rental income due to location and demand.
6. Future Growth
Consider the future growth of the area. Areas with upcoming infrastructure projects, metro connectivity, or business hubs are likely to have increasing property values.
Popular Areas for Commercial Property in Delhi
Delhi has many areas known for commercial properties. Here are some popular options:
1. Connaught Place
Connaught Place is the heart of Delhi’s business activities. It has offices, retail shops, restaurants, and malls. High demand here means higher property prices but good rental returns.
2. Saket and South Delhi
Saket and nearby South Delhi areas have shopping malls, offices, and corporate buildings. This area is suitable for both businesses and investors.
3. Gurugram (Nearby Delhi)
Gurugram is technically in Haryana but is part of the National Capital Region (NCR). It has many IT parks, offices, and industrial hubs. Investing here can be profitable due to rapid growth.
4. Karol Bagh and Chandni Chowk
These areas are famous for retail shops and wholesale markets. Businesses in these areas attract high customer traffic.
5. Okhla and Bawana
These areas are known for warehouses and industrial buildings. They are suitable for logistics and manufacturing businesses.
Benefits of Owning Commercial Property in Delhi
Investing in commercial property in Delhi offers several benefits:
-
Steady Income: Renting out offices or shops can provide regular rental income.
-
High Appreciation: Property value in Delhi generally increases over time.
-
Business Growth: Owning a commercial space helps establish your business and attract customers.
-
Tax Benefits: Certain taxes and expenses on commercial property can be claimed as deductions.
Challenges of Commercial Property in Delhi
Like any investment, commercial property also has challenges:
-
High Initial Investment: Commercial properties are expensive.
-
Legal Complications: Improper documentation can lead to legal disputes.
-
Maintenance Costs: Commercial buildings require regular maintenance.
-
Market Fluctuations: Property prices may rise or fall depending on demand.
